Consider moving projects custom code to separate extensions instead of keeping it in the conf.py.
This would make easier to maintain the code as it would be separated in different files.
Affected projects:
- java-driver (doxygen & replace links)
- scylla-cloud (autogenerate openapi)
- rust-driver (replace file names)